Output defc86c3e077bcc1d650153ba270e7e0d84b2991971782e857342c277174f8fa:9

value
503960
script pubkey
OP_0 OP_PUSHBYTES_20 5abdc035caaef245bc5505fd5022a2a948508f94
address
bc1qt27uqdw24meyt0z4qh74qg4z49y9pru5jnkr02
transaction
defc86c3e077bcc1d650153ba270e7e0d84b2991971782e857342c277174f8fa
spent
true